好的,希望这对你来说应该很容易。我是git,BitBucket的新手,也是版本控制的新手,我将会遗漏一些明显的东西。
所以这就是我所做的:我已经在我的机器上安装了git并设置了我的全局变量。在BitBucket上设置一个新的仓库。然后:
$ git clone https://[me]@bitbucket.org/[me]/[my_project].git
我在本地创建一个新文件(index.html),添加并提交:
$ git add index.html
$ git commit -m "Initial commit."
[master (root-commit) 01d4120] Initial commit.
1 files changed, 164 insertions(+), 0 deletions(-)
create mode 100755 index.html
成功提交。
$ git push
Password:
Everything up-to-date
我输入密码aaaaa ... Everything up-to-date
...它没有推动。我只是想从我当地的行李箱直接推到远程行李箱。
我很抱歉,如果这是非常明显的,但我对一切似乎都没有找到任何信息的新手,我只是在尝试“BitBucket 101”步骤。欢呼声。
答案 0 :(得分:16)
你必须这样做:
git push origin master
如果您有不同的遥控器,请更改原点。
如果您有不同的分支,请更改主数据。
答案 1 :(得分:1)
我不确定这是bitbucket.org还是GIT的问题。
克隆项目后。在本地配置中,您具有远程设备的原始设置。但还没有分支信息。所以你必须使用'$ git push origin'来做一次。之后。你可以简单地使用'$ git push'。
'$ git push -v'会有助于找到问题。它打印出详细信息。